Yapay Zeka, Programları Kimin Yazdığını Ortaya Çıkaracak

In Haber by Ruşen GöbelLeave a Comment

Yapay zeka, herhangi bir programı derinlemesine inceleyerek kodun sahibini bulabilecek.

Yapay zekanın kullanım alanı günden güne genişlerken, zaman zaman çok ilginç fikirler ve uygulamalarla da karşılaşıyoruz. Bir grup araştırmacı program kodlarına bakarak, bu kodların kim tarafından yazıldığını ortaya çıkarabilen bir yapay zeka geliştirdi.

Her ne kadar her yazılım dilinin belirli bir yapısı olsa da, bunun nasıl kullanılacağı yazılımcılara kalmış. Her yazılımcı, kodlarını kendine özgü bir şekilde yazıyor. Geliştirilen yapay zeka ise yazılan kodlardaki ince ayrıntıları gözden geçirerek yazılımın sahibini saptayabiliyor.

Yapay zekanın test edilmesi için 600 farklı yazılımcıdan, toplam 4.800 adet kod örneği kullanılmış. Yapay zeka, bu kodlara bakarak %83 oranda yazan kişiyi doğru şekilde belirlemiş.

Yapay zekanın kötü amaçlı yazılım ve virüsleri geliştirenlerin bulunmasında fayda sağlayabileceği düşünülüyor. Ayrıca yazılım ve oyun dünyasında zaman zaman karşılaştığımız kod hırsızlığı gibi konularda da yardımcı olabilir.